Commercial Cygnus space freighter leaves station after two months
CAPE CANAVERAL — Disconnected from the International Space Station berthing port and then cast free by the robotic arm, the commercial Cygnus cargo craft flew away today after successfully restarting U.S. resupply service to the outpost. The Orbital ATK maneuvering freighter was released from Canadarm2 at 7:26 a.m. EST (1226 GMT) some 250 miles above…

Atlas 5 rocket sends Cygnus in hot pursuit of space station
CAPE CANAVERAL — Bound for an orbital rendezvous with the International Space Station on Wednesday, a commercial Cygnus freighter was successfully launched by an Atlas 5 rocket this afternoon to restart American cargo deliveries to the research outpost. The United Launch Alliance booster rocket lifted off at 4:44:57 p.m. EST (2144:57 GMT) from Cape Canaveral…
